linux上安装Loadrunner负载机

1.下载Load Generator 安装文件:Linux.zip

   链接:https://pan.baidu.com/s/1kPpJY8IFeKB24DbMcH_t_g 密码:jyee

2.把下载文件上传到Linux

3.解压Linux.zip,unzip Linux.zip

4.更改Linux下所有文件的权限,chmod 777 -R Linux/

5.进入Linux文件夹,运行installer.sh文件

6.启动LR 负载端:

   1) cd /opt/HP/HP_LoadGenerator/bin

   2)  ./verify_generator

   3)输入csh提示没有该命令,需要安装csh

   4)安装依赖包:yum -y install glibc.i686

   5)yum -y install libstdc++.so.5

  6)修改/etc/csh.cshrc文件

    vi /etc /csh.cshrc在文件的最后加上      source /opt/HP/HP_LoadGenerator/env.csh

   7)    vi /opt/HP/HP_LoadGenerator/env.csh

 

将第9行注释,修改为:

setenv LD_LIBRARY_PATH ${M_LROOT}/bin:${M_LROOT}/lib:/usr/lib

在文件的最后加上:setenv DISPLAY 0.0(保存的时候使用:wq!)

8)输入env,然后找到 HOSTNAME=xxxx

  然后输入hostname,查看hostname的值

【注意】如果和上面env的值不一样,修改hosts文件

vi /etc/hosts 把127.0.0.1 后面加上xxxx,也就是env中hostname=的值,例如:  

127.0.0.1   localhost localhost.localdomain localhost4 localhost4.localdomain4 xxxxxx在后面加上xxxx

9)添加用户:useradd -g 0 -s /bin/csh lr_test

10)切换用户:su lr_test

11) cd /opt/HP/HP_LoadGenerator/bin

         ./verify_generator

12)启动LR负载端    ./m_daemon_setup start

7.检查是否启动成功:ps -ef | grep m_agent_daemon

   关闭防火墙:service iptables stop

 8.在windows上打开Controller端,建立场景, 选择要执行的脚本,在Design模式下,点击 右边的Generators,在弹出的小窗口中点击Add, 添加新的Load Generator,在name处填写linux的IP地址,在Platform处,选择UNIX,点击more,在Unix Environment 标签下,勾选Don't use RSH项,点击 “OK”按钮

 

9.在Load Generators 页面中选择在刚添加的负载机上, 点击“Connect”, 连接成功

猜你喜欢

转载自www.cnblogs.com/tudouxifan/p/8949637.html